DLT vs 40/80 don't accept tapes from other drives
Hi!
I have two DLT VS 40/80 internal drives that simply won't take used tapes from other drives (DLT 40/80 and 35/70). I can use only new tapes or the existing set of tapes. When I insert one used tape to be erased it tries to read and then it just ejects the tape. Any ideias to solve this. One of the drives was already exchanged.
Thanks for any ideas.

Re: DLT vs 40/80 don't accept tapes from other drives
Alberto,
The VS80 uses a different format than the other DLT drives and therefore will not read tape written by them. You cannot format them to work either. About the only option you have is bulk erase and even that's not a great idea
